perifuse
perifuse, v. Med. (ˈpɛrɪfjuːz) [f. peri- after perfuse v. 3.] trans. To subject to an enveloping flow of liquid. So ˈperifused ppl. a.1969 Lancet 25 Oct. 882/1 (heading) Dynamic aspects of proinsulin release from perifused rat pancreas. 1972 Diabetes XXI. 989/2 The islets were perifused with glucose... superfuse
superfuse, v. (s(j)uːpəˈfjuːz) [f. L. superfūs-, pa. ppl. stem of superfundĕre: see super- 2 and fuse v. In sense 3, a new formation on superfusion 2.] 1. a. trans. To pour over or on something.1657 Tomlinson Renou's Disp. 162* Either a Ptisane or decoction..must be superfused. 1677 Gale Crt. Gentil... Oxford English Dictionary
